According to a report by CNN, the 2025 Beauty and Personal Care Content Report reveals that high-risk chemicals, such as those found in shampoos, conditioners, foundations, and lipsticks, are still prevalent in products. Hidden dangers not listed on labels include PFAS chemicals detected in 52% of 231 cosmetic products sold in the US and Canada. These substances are known to disrupt hormone balance and are associated with health issues, including cancer. Furthermore, the report found that 88% of products do not list these chemicals on their labels.
Experts highlight that chemicals like formaldehyde in hair straighteners are particularly common in products targeting black women, emphasizing their link to cancer. The report lists the most concerning chemicals to watch out for, including Cyclopentasiloxane and Cyclomethicone (silicone derivatives), Methylparaben (hormone disruptor), BHT (endocrine disruptor and environmentally toxic), and D&C Red 27, 28 (colorants affecting the immune and reproductive systems).
Chemical safety expert Heather McKenney stresses, “Consumers should not have to figure out which products are safe. This responsibility lies with manufacturers,” calling for more transparency in the industry. The report by ChemFORWARD organization notes a 2% decrease in hazardous chemicals and an increase in safe formulations. However, approximately 4% of 50,000 products still contain high-risk ingredients.
